...and the show in the morning sky continues... 🙂 Mercury was 0.1 mag brighter this morning than yesterday, which you can see. Unfortunately, the sky wasn't quite as clear as yesterday. Castor and Pollux can also be seen in the constellation Gemini at the top left. Canon EOS 6D + Pentacon 1.8/50 (F5.6), ISO 200, 3.2s, 05:08 CEST
